Nov 16, 2023 · Remove Clog and Rinse. Use pliers to straighten out a wire hanger and make a hook at one end. Carefully lower the wire into the drain and use the hooked end to pull out the clog, repeating as needed until the drain is clear. Run hot water down the drain to flush out any remaining buildup. Be sure to use distilled white vinegar instead of apple cider vinegar, as the latter can stain ...Ammonia is an alkaline cleaner, which means it is effective at cutting through grease and oil. It can also be effective at removing soap scum and grime from tile surfaces. However, it can be harsh on some types of tile, and it should never be mixed with other cleaning products, as this can produce toxic fumes. Fill the bottle the rest of the way with ...To remove black mold from hard surfaces, follow these steps: Combine 1 part bleach with 2 parts water in a spray bottle and spritz the affected area. Let the solution sit for 10 minutes.
